There is no way this home was properly inspected before I moved in -- it had a propane leak, HVAC leaks, and no dryer venting system, which created a major fire hazard. Despite these issues, I took great care of the property, did all the yard work myself, and even paid $400 for professional cleaning when I moved out to leave the place in good condition. Yet I was charged more than $2,000 in move-out costs, including full carpet replacement (for "pet smell" despite the carpet being in good visible condition) and $281 for "tile cleaning", even though the tiles had already been professionally cleaned. After three years of normal occupancy, these are clearly normal wear and tear, and charging me for full replacement is completely unreasonable. These charges go far beyond normal wear and tear after three years of tenancy. When I raised concerns, management dismissed them and said the owner would not take responsibility. I've rented for years and never had issues like this with any other landlord. I do NOT recommend buying a home from them or going through them for rentals.

Upon my move out, Jessica remarked on how clean the home was and the work we put in to get the home to a great place. During the final inspection the only items called out were some drawers that needed to be wiped down, a few hedges I did not trim in the backyard and 3 missing lightbulbs. 26 days later and I still do not have my security deposit back and when I asked, I was told the carpets had to be recleaned due to some pet odor. The carpets were already professionally cleaned before my move out and this was not called out during the inspection or in the 3 weeks that followed. In fact Jessica even remarked at how good the carpets looked during the inspection. The whole point of the move out inspection, and the obligation to allow the tenant to be present, is to ensure things like this do not happen and tenants are not charged for these kind of speculative things. But Coldwell Banker is unbelievably shady in how they do business and waited 26 days to let me know. I would not recommend anyone use their services if it can be avoided. Some other issues I had: - An old sandbox in the backyard, which was there upon my move in, was infested with copperhead snakes and my lawn services refused to continue to mow. When I contacted Jessica, she told me this would be my responsibility to pay to remove. I had no choice but to pay to get something removed from the home that was not mine and presented a serious health and safety risk. - The air quality in the house was terrible and was causing severe skin issues for my partner and myself. The previous tenants resorted to putting filters over every air return to help. When I brought this up to Jessica, she told me that it is common for people to do this to block the air from coming out - even though I found vent filters in the closet from the last tenants. It took a month or more of back and forth to get a cheap service to come out and do the duct cleaning. They had multiple providers come out and of course they went with the cheapest and worst option. In person Jessica seemed nice and respectful, but at every opportunity her and her company have looked for any reason to charge me and push normal expenses back on to me. Avoid at all costs!!
